如何将Payara 4.1.2.173添加到NetBeans 8.1

如何将Payara 4.1.2.173添加到NetBeans 8.1,netbeans,glassfish,payara,Netbeans,Glassfish,Payara,我正在使用NetBeans 8.1(我无法升级到8.2),并且一直在使用Payara 4.1.2.172,没有任何问题。我想开始使用Payara 4.1.2.173。和往常一样,我只是下载了Payara压缩包,解压缩它,并试图将其作为GlassFish服务器添加到NetBeans中。但当我选择解压Payara 4.1.2.173的文件夹时,NetBeans告诉我它“不是一个有效的GlassFish服务器安装” 我是否应该更改Payara 4.1.2.173文件夹结构中的任何内容以允许NetBea

我正在使用NetBeans 8.1(我无法升级到8.2),并且一直在使用Payara 4.1.2.172,没有任何问题。我想开始使用Payara 4.1.2.173。和往常一样,我只是下载了Payara压缩包,解压缩它,并试图将其作为GlassFish服务器添加到NetBeans中。但当我选择解压Payara 4.1.2.173的文件夹时,NetBeans告诉我它“不是一个有效的GlassFish服务器安装”

我是否应该更改Payara 4.1.2.173文件夹结构中的任何内容以允许NetBeans将其识别为GlassFish服务器?

有两种方法:

1.修复阻止Payara服务器作为GlassFish添加的问题 这里的问题在于NetBeans检测您试图添加的GlassFish版本的方式。有一个特定的JAR文件,其中包含GlassFish/Payara服务器的版本号。Payara对此的修复是在构建过程中重命名文件,但您可以自己手动重命名以解决此问题

在文件夹中:

./glassfish/lib/install/applications/__admingui/WEB-INF/lib/
您将找到具有以下名称的文件:

console-core-4.1.2.173.jar
应将其重命名为:

console-core-4.1.1.jar
2.使用新的Payara服务器NetBeans插件添加Payara服务器 Payara服务器的NetBeans中现在有了本机插件。有4个可用,但都是必需的。通过使用
工具
->
插件
并搜索Payara,可以通过NetBeans添加它们


我更愿意使用该插件,但这只适用于8.2。重命名JAR对我来说很有效。@JasperdeVries根据您的反馈,我们添加了Payara插件作为NetBeans 8.1的一个选项。支持最新版本和Payara Server 5快照。享受吧!谢谢我刚做了第一次部署。。一切都很顺利!